The term CLF in the context of the Marine Chain of Command (COC) stands for "Combat Logistics Force." This designation refers to the units tasked with providing logistical support to combat operations, ensuring that troops receive the necessary supplies, equipment, and maintenance to sustain their efforts. The Combat Logistics Force plays a critical role in operational readiness and the successful execution of missions by facilitating the flow of logistical support necessary for troops in the field.
